Why Repiping Costs Vary in Tavares, Florida

Repiping costs in Tavares depend on several local factors. The age of your home plays a major role: older homes often have galvanized steel or polybutylene pipes that are more labor-intensive to replace. Tavares's humid climate can cause copper pipes to corrode faster, while sandy soil may affect the condition of underground lines. Florida's strict plumbing code requires licensed plumbers to follow specific material and installation standards, which can affect labor rates. The local labor market also influences pricing, as demand for skilled plumbers fluctuates with the area's growth. Additionally, the layout of your home—such as crawlspace access versus slab foundation—impacts the time and complexity of the job. Permitting fees from the city's permitting office add a small cost, but ensure the work meets code.

Common Repiping Issues in Tavares Homes

  1. 1

    Galvanized Pipe Corrosion

    Many Tavares homes built before the 1970s used galvanized steel pipes, which corrode from the inside due to the area's hard water and humidity, leading to reduced water flow and rusty water.

  2. 2

    Polybutylene Pipe Deterioration

    Homes from the 1970s to 1990s may have polybutylene pipes, which become brittle in Florida's heat and are prone to sudden leaks, often requiring full repiping.

  3. 3

    Slab Leaks from Copper Pipes

    Copper pipes in slab foundations can develop pinhole leaks due to acidic soil and high moisture in Tavares, causing hidden water damage and costly repairs.

  4. 4

    Freeze Damage in Winter

    Though rare, occasional hard freezes in Central Florida can cause exposed pipes to burst, especially in older homes without proper insulation.

  5. 5

    Tree Root Intrusion

    Tavares's sandy soil and mature trees encourage root growth into underground sewer lines, which can damage pipes and necessitate repiping of affected sections.

Q · 03

What are Florida's licensing requirements for plumbers?

In Florida, plumbers must be licensed by the state. The Florida Board of Plumbing Examiners oversees licensing, which requires passing an exam and meeting experience requirements. For repiping, always hire a licensed plumber to ensure the work meets the state of Florida's plumbing code and to protect your home's value.

Q · 04

How long does a repiping project take in Tavares?

A full repipe typically takes 3 to 7 days, depending on the home's size and complexity. In Tavares, factors like slab foundations or limited access can extend the timeline. Your plumber should provide a schedule and minimize disruption to your daily routine.

Q · 05

Do I need a permit for repiping in Tavares?

Yes, most repiping projects require a permit from the city's permitting office. Your plumber should handle the permit application and schedule inspections. This ensures the work meets local building codes and protects you from future issues. Skipping permits can lead to fines or problems when selling your home.
